The sulfur(VI) fluoride exchange (SuFEx)‐based polycondensation reaction between bisalkylsulfonyl fluorides and bisphenol bis( tert ‐butyldimethylsilyl) ethers using [Ph 3 P=N−PPh 3 ]+[HF 2 ] − as the catalyst was been developed. As described by P. Wu, K. B. Sharpless et al. in their Communication on page 11203 ff., polysulfonates synthesized by this method can be further functionalized using click‐chemistry‐based transformations orthogonal to SuFEx.
